About

Chan Kyu Kim is a scholar working on Mechanical Engineering, Electrical and Electronic Engineering and Materials Chemistry. According to data from OpenAlex, Chan Kyu Kim has authored 29 papers receiving a total of 357 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Mechanical Engineering, 8 papers in Electrical and Electronic Engineering and 7 papers in Materials Chemistry. Recurrent topics in Chan Kyu Kim’s work include Additive Manufacturing Materials and Processes (8 papers), Welding Techniques and Residual Stresses (6 papers) and Additive Manufacturing and 3D Printing Technologies (4 papers). Chan Kyu Kim is often cited by papers focused on Additive Manufacturing Materials and Processes (8 papers), Welding Techniques and Residual Stresses (6 papers) and Additive Manufacturing and 3D Printing Technologies (4 papers). Chan Kyu Kim collaborates with scholars based in South Korea and United States. Chan Kyu Kim's co-authors include Hee Sung, Paresh Chandra Ray, Jelani Griffin, Gopala Krishna Darbha, Rajamohan R. Kalluru, Young Tae Cho, Ki‐Hyun Kim, Geun Young Yeom, Yong Soo Cho and Chaehun Lee and has published in prestigious journals such as Chemical Physics Letters, Optics Express and Advanced Science.
